Non-Invasive Prenatal Testing (NIPT) Market: Trends and Forecast Through 2035

Non-Invasive Prenatal Testing (NIPT) Market Overview

The Non-Invasive Prenatal Testing (NIPT) Market focuses on advanced prenatal screening technologies that analyze cell-free fetal DNA from a mother’s blood to assess the risk of chromosomal and genetic abnormalities. NIPT provides a non-invasive approach to prenatal screening and supports the early identification of conditions such as trisomy and sex chromosome abnormalities. The market was valued at USD 1.82 billion in 2024 and is projected to reach USD 5.502 billion by 2035, growing at a CAGR of 10.58% during 2025–2035.

Market Drivers

Increasing Prevalence of Genetic and Chromosomal Disorders: The rising prevalence and awareness of chromosomal abnormalities and genetic disorders are increasing demand for prenatal screening. NIPT enables healthcare professionals to assess the risk of conditions such as trisomy and other fetal chromosomal abnormalities at an early stage.

Growing Awareness of Prenatal Screening: Increasing awareness among expectant parents and healthcare providers regarding early fetal health assessment is supporting the adoption of NIPT. The availability of non-invasive screening through maternal blood samples has contributed to growing acceptance of these tests.

Technological Advancements in Genetic Testing: Advancements in next-generation sequencing, massively parallel sequencing, microarray analysis, and cell-free DNA analysis are improving the capabilities of NIPT. These technologies are expanding the range of genetic conditions that can be evaluated through prenatal screening.

Growing Focus on Early Detection: Early identification of potential fetal chromosomal abnormalities allows healthcare professionals and expectant parents to make informed decisions regarding further diagnostic evaluation and pregnancy management. This increasing emphasis on early prenatal assessment is supporting market expansion.

Increasing Healthcare Access and Adoption: Improvements in healthcare infrastructure, diagnostic laboratory capabilities, and access to advanced genetic testing are contributing to the adoption of NIPT across developed and emerging markets. Asia-Pacific is experiencing rapid growth as awareness and healthcare access increase.

Market Challenges

High Cost of NIPT: The cost of advanced prenatal genetic testing can be relatively high compared with conventional screening methods. Limited insurance coverage and affordability issues may restrict access to NIPT in some markets.

Regulatory and Ethical Considerations: NIPT involves genetic information and prenatal screening, creating regulatory, ethical, and counseling considerations. Differences in regulatory requirements across countries can influence market expansion and commercialization.

Limited Access in Developing Regions: Limited availability of specialized diagnostic laboratories, sequencing infrastructure, trained professionals, and genetic counseling services can restrict the adoption of NIPT in certain developing regions.

Need for Confirmatory Diagnostic Testing: NIPT is a screening test rather than a definitive diagnostic test. Positive screening results generally require appropriate follow-up diagnostic evaluation, which can add complexity and cost to the prenatal care process.

Competition from Conventional Screening Methods: Traditional prenatal screening approaches, including biochemical screening and ultrasound-based methods, continue to be used widely and compete with NIPT technologies in several healthcare settings.

Regional Insights

North America: North America was the largest regional market in 2024, with the market valued at approximately USD 0.785 billion. The region benefits from advanced healthcare infrastructure, high adoption of genetic testing technologies, and increasing awareness of prenatal screening.

Europe: Europe followed North America, with a market valuation of approximately USD 0.585 billion in 2024. Established healthcare systems and increasing accessibility to prenatal screening support regional demand.

Asia-Pacific: The Asia-Pacific market was valued at approximately USD 0.325 billion in 2024 and is projected to reach around USD 1.0 billion by 2035. Increasing healthcare access, rising disposable incomes, and growing awareness are supporting market development across countries such as China and India.

Rest of the World: South America and the Middle East & Africa represent developing markets. Improvements in healthcare facilities and growing investment in genetic testing technologies are expected to create additional opportunities.
